Lugari Constituency

Lugari Constituency is an electoral constituency in Kenya. It is one of twelve constituencies in Kakamega County, and the only constituency in the former Lugari District. The entire constituency has eight wards, all of which elect representatives for the Kakamega County Assembly. The constituency was established for the 1988 elections.
